Pricing that stays honest
How Duct Area Safety Nets quotes are built in Kodumudi, Erode, Erode
We do not publish a fake national ₹/sq ft band that pretends every balcony is the same. Instead you get unit clarity, a quote checklist, and a photo estimate path — so you can compare any vendor (including us) without guessing.

Measured size and shape
Width, height, returns, corners, and irregular edges decide quantity. Photos help shortlist; survey locks the number.

Purpose and material
Child spacing, bird mesh, monkey-grade denier, and coastal 316 cable are different specs — not one generic “safety product”.

Access and fixing surface
Floor height, scaffold or gondola, railing type, and concrete vs metal change labour and hardware even at the same area.

Finish and aftercare
Edge finishing, colour match, tension checks, warranty visits, and what must appear on the written quotation before install day.
Price units by system (ask for the unit first)
Clearer units than a thin four-card price band — so quotes stay comparable.
| System | Typical unit | Must be named on the quote |
|---|---|---|
| Invisible grills | Usually by fitted opening area (or bay count) | Cable grade (304/316), spacing, frame finish, openable bays |
| Balcony / child safety nets | Usually by fitted mesh area | Denier/UV grade, aperture, border rope, return sides |
| Transparent / low-vis nets | Usually by fitted mesh area | Strand colour, denier, mesh size, edge treatment |
| Pigeon / anti-bird nets | Usually by covered opening area | Full-opening vs ledge-only, mesh size, duct returns |
| Bird spikes | Usually by running length of ledge | Base material, glue vs screw fix, bird species pressure |
| Monkey-grade nets | Usually by fitted area + reinforcement extras | Denier, corner plates, pull-tested anchors |
| Sports / cricket nets | By lane size or panel set | Impact rating, posts, shared-terrace rules |
| Cloth hangers | By system (rails/lines), not balcony sq ft | Ceiling vs wall, pulley count, stainless grade |
Written-quote checklist (use this on every vendor)
- 1Price unit stated (₹/sq ft of fitted area, per bay, per running metre, or per system)
- 2Measured openings listed bay by bay (W × H), not one guessed room total
- 3Material grade named (e.g. SS 304/316 cable, UV HDPE denier) — not only “stainless”
- 4Spacing or mesh aperture written in mm or inches
- 5Access notes (floor, scaffold/cradle, society time window)
- 6Inclusions: labour, hardware, finishing, GST line, warranty duration
- 7Exclusions: civil make-good, painting, association fees, remobilisation
- 8Minimum job charge (if any) shown separately from unit rate

Will my apartment association need to approve the work?
In most gated communities and housing societies, yes, because anything fixed to an external wall or balcony counts as a facade alteration. We can supply the drawings and material specification you need to submit. It is worth starting that process early, since approval usually takes longer than the installation itself.
My net or cable has gone slack. Is that a problem?
It needs attention but rarely means replacement. Slack in a cable widens the gap under load, which is the thing a barrier exists to prevent, and slack in a net lets it whip and abrade against fixings. Both are usually corrected by re-tensioning at the existing hardware, which is a short visit rather than a new installation.
Does living near the sea change what I should install?
Substantially. Chloride in coastal air pits ordinary stainless, so we move to AISI 316 cable and use stainless fittings throughout, and we avoid galvanised hardware entirely. We also seal terminations and detail them so water drains away rather than sitting against the wall, because that is where coastal installations usually fail first.

If you net our duct, how do we service the pipes later?
Access has to be designed in from the start, which is why we form laced access panels at agreed positions and record where they are for the facilities team. A net with no access provision gets cut open the first time the riser needs work and is never repaired, which defeats the whole installation.
Is there a cheaper specification that is still safe?
Sometimes. Moving from 316 to 304 stainless is a genuine saving and perfectly sound at an inland address, and a coarser mesh is fine if you only need to keep birds out. What we will not do is reduce cable spacing tolerance or anchor quality, because those are the two things that decide whether the installation actually holds.
How often should an installation be checked?
Once a year is right for most installations, and it is largely something you can do yourself: press the cables or net at mid-span to feel for slack, look at the anchor points for rust weeping or hairline cracking, and wash the surfaces down. In coastal and cyclone-exposed locations we recommend an additional check after the wet season.
Our shaft is full of nesting material. Is that included?
Clearing is quoted separately because the volume varies enormously, but it is not optional. Netting over an existing nest traps the problem instead of solving it and is inhumane besides. We clear and photograph the shaft before any panel goes in, and agree disposal arrangements with the building management first.
Will pigeons find a way back in after netting?
Only if the enclosure was left with a gap, which in practice means a corner or a service penetration that was not properly closed. A correctly fitted net denies access outright. That is why we clear existing nesting material first and check corners and pipe penetrations last, since those are where birds actually get through.
